Overview
The AD5648ARUZ-2REEL7 is a low-power, octal, 14-bit, buffered voltage-output Digital-to-Analog Converter (DAC) produced by Analog Devices Inc. This device operates from a single 2.7 V to 5.5 V supply and is guaranteed monotonic by design. It features an on-chip precision output amplifier that enables rail-to-rail output swing and is available in a 16-lead TSSOP package.

Key Features
- Low power consumption with a single 2.7 V to 5.5 V supply.
- Octal, 14-bit, buffered voltage-output DAC.
- On-chip precision output amplifier enabling rail-to-rail output swing.
- On-chip reference with an internal gain of 2, available in 1.25 V and 2.5 V options.
- Power-on reset circuit ensuring DAC output powers up to 0 V or midscale.
- Power-down feature reducing current consumption to 400 nA at 5 V.
- Software-selectable output loads while in power-down mode.
- Versatile 3-wire serial interface compatible with SPI, QSPI, MICROWIRE, and DSP interface standards, operating at clock rates up to 50 MHz.
- Asynchronous CLR function to update all DACs to a user-programmable code.
